WebFOLFIRI is the name of a chemotherapy combination that includes: folinic acid (also called leucovorin, calcium folinate or FA) fluorouracil (also called 5FU) irinotecan. FOLFIRI is also known as irinotecan de Gramont or irinotecan modified de Gramont.
